Hey Guys,
My name is Justin and I just bought my 2005 MINI Cooper S. I live in Alberta, Canada. The car is an '05 MCS and it has 55,000KMs on it (35,000 Miles). It is a 6spd manual.
I think I did well with this model, it seems to have everything but navigation! The previous owner loved black, so it is all black. (This is great because black is my thing as well!) Here are the specs on it:
Jet Black on Panther Black Gravity Leather, Sport Package, Premium Package, All-Weather Visibility Package, Limited Slip Differntial, Anthracite Roofliner, Rain Sensing Wipers, Automatic Headlights, Fog Lights Front and Rear, Anthracite Interior Surface Trim, Harmon Kardon Sound System, Auto Climate Control (Digital). That's all I can remember for now. It also came with a second send of rims and tires for winter!
My previous car, which I still have, is a '00 Pontiac Grand Prix GTP which is modded. Rims, lowered, tint, engine work, etc. I love superchargers (the GTP is a 3.8L Supercharged V6). I love how the MCS is supercharged too.
Well, I want to get tint done first, then some minor exterior parts. I want to keep this thing mint and I need to give it a name!

Xenon lights weren't standard on any of the models, but they were part of the "Sport Package" on the 'S', so that's how a lot of people got them. You could order them as an a la carte option as well if you didn't want the other items in the Sport package.

I just got the Chrono Pack because it solved two problems for me - it moved the speedometer to the steering column where I'm used to it being, and it addresses the MINI's almost complete lack of gauges.
I don't know anything about the heated windshield, because the U.S. cars don't have that as an available option. The Cold Weather Package had heated seats, heated washer jets and heated mirrors.
